CELEBRITY chef Paul Askew will be hosting an extra special festive cooking event at Birkenhead Market.
'Cooking into Christmas' will take place on Saturday, November 30 and sees Paul bring together seasonal produce while celebrating shopping local and supporting local traders.
Paul will deliver three live chef demos on the day demonstrating how keen cooks can make festive feasts on a budget to impress the family this Christmas.
He will be joined by Adopt a School - an organisation that sends chefs and hospitality professionals into schools to teach children about food, healthy eating and the importance of eating together.
The Children's Cooking Zone will feature three sessions as part of the event.
